Advancing Through Innovation, FAW Group Gains Strong Momentum
FAW Group recently released its overall production and sales figures for May. It sold over 261,300 vehicles, a year-on-year increase of 7.5%, and produced 245,000 vehicles, a year-on-year increase of 9.3%. Among them, sales of self-owned passenger vehicles reached 46,900 units, a year-on-year increase of 17.2%, while monthly sales of self-owned new energy vehicles exceeded 23,200 units, surging by more than 69.8%. Additionally, sales of joint venture vehicles totaled 193,400 units, securing a leading position in the industry.

Self-Owned Brands Scale New Heights
FAW's impressive performance in May owes much to the outstanding contributions of its self-owned brands. Among them, Hongqi continued to solidify its presence in the high-end market through strengthened brand marketing efforts.
In May, Hongqi once again partnered with the Changchun Marathon and the Frankfurt International Dragon Boat Friendship Race, fully demonstrating its brand charm and vitality. In terms of model updates, the 2025 Hongqi H9 was officially launched on May 20, garnering widespread attention across the industry. The model features comprehensive upgrades in driving performance, luxury presence, and comfort. Furthermore, it comes standard with 20-inch wheel hubs, run-flat tires, and a "premium lighting package" valued at RMB 6,800, catering to diverse consumer preferences and gaining popularity for its stunning design.
In the fiercely competitive commercial vehicle market, FAW Jiefang has maintained its leading position, securing a 22.4% terminal market share for medium and heavy-duty trucks in China in May. In particular, its new energy heavy-duty trucks made significant strides in products featuring bottom-swapping of battery packs, with orders exceeding 1,000 units.
FAW Jiefang's brand influence in China's commercial vehicle sector continues to grow. At the next-generation heavy-duty truck battery-swapping ecosystem launch event hosted by the China Communications and Transportation Association and CATL, FAW Jiefang signed a strategic cooperation agreement with Times Qiji, under which the two parties will co-develop industry-leading models featuring bottom-swapping of battery packs and explore new business opportunities. In addition, FAW Jiefang and ANE Logistics reached a consensus on cooperating in the application of new energy intelligent commercial vehicles and logistics ecosystem development. On May 27, FAW Jiefang celebrated the delivery of 1,000 new energy vehicles in the Beijing-Tianjin-Hebei region. On May 29, FAW Jiefang's Sichuan branch rolled out its 10,000th vehicle of 2025, demonstrating the remarkable "Jiefang Speed".
Meanwhile, Bestune accelerated its innovation in technology, product offerings, and marketing, achieving 17,407 units in sales for May, a record high for its NEVs. Notably, Bestune Yueyi 03 secured over 5,000 orders in a month, while the global debut of the electric-hybrid SUV Yueyi 07 further enriched the brand's product lineup, offering consumers a more diverse range of choices.
Joint Venture Sector Achieves Stable Growth
As the "barometer" of FAW's joint venture operations, FAW-Volkswagen has focused on intelligent manufacturing since the beginning of this year, achieving a series of breakthroughs. In May, the company sold 128,303 vehicles, with its fuel vehicle market share increasing by 1.5% year-on-year.
Since early May, FAW-Volkswagen has deepened its client ecosystem operations through the 5th "521 Family Carnival". The 11th Employee Family Open Day, held during the event, attracted over 100,000 participants, including employees' families, clients, and partners. Centered on the concept of "family culture", a range of innovative and caring activities showcased the company's breakthroughs in electrification and smart technologies while fostering a deeper emotional connection between the company and its clients.
On May 19, FAW-Volkswagen, in partnership with Huawei Cloud, unveiled China's first "cloud-based" distributed automobile factory at its Foshan branch. By deeply integrating FAW-Volkswagen's business practices with Huawei Cloud's distributed technology, the smart factory network linking FAW-Volkswagen's northern and southern sites officially took shape.
At the 2025 Guangdong-Hong Kong-Macao Greater Bay Area Auto Show, FAW Audi made a strong impression with 10 blockbuster models, including Audi A5L (debut model on the brand-new PPC luxury fuel platform), Audi Q7, Audi SQ7, Audi Q8, Audi RS Q8, Audi A8L, and Audi A8L Horch.
FAW Toyota has maintained its positive growth momentum, with sales continuing to rise. In May, it sold 68,127 vehicles, a year-on-year increase of 24%. Following a year-on-year increase of 9.6% in Q1 and a 32% increase in April, the company extended its upward trajectory. In May, it organized a media test drive of the new bZ5. Covering various driving scenarios from Beijing to Jinshanling Aranya, the comprehensive test drive experience enabled media and auto reviewers to appreciate the model's outstanding safety standards. Built on the E-NTGA architecture and equipped with Momenta 5.0 + TSS intelligent driving technology, the model delivers excellent intelligent driver-assistance performance.
Global Expansion Gains Momentum
As FAW Group concentrates its superior resources to expand its market footprint, its influence in overseas markets keeps growing.
Hongqi made a debut at the Poznan Motor Show and the Krakow Film Festival, igniting enthusiasm for Chinese brands in Poland with its "Oriental Luxury" brand positioning. The flagship models, Hongqi HQ9 luxury MPV and Hongqi HS7 SUV, entered the Myanmar market, marking the brand's new journey into Southeast Asia.
The launch of FAW Jiefang's J6P heavy-duty truck in Senegal laid a solid foundation for the brand to continuously expand international markets and deepen international cooperation. At the 2025 World New Energy Vehicle Congress held on May 20, FAW Jiefang had in-depth exchanges with relevant departments from Oman, Qatar, the UAE, and other countries on hydrogen energy application cooperation, overseas investment layout, autonomous driving regulation formulation, etc. It also signed orders totaling nearly 10,000 Jiefang trucks with top dealers and major clients in Saudi Arabia and other markets, demonstrating the tangible results of FAW Jiefang's "SPRINT2030" internationalization strategy.
Upholding its commitment to high-quality development, FAW Group is accelerating its open development to foster shared prosperity across the industrial ecosystem. In May this year, it made significant moves by first signing a strategic cooperation agreement with Tsinghua Unigroup to build an industry benchmark for "chip + automobile" collaboration, and then partnering with COFCO to develop shared platforms in logistics, transportation, and sales channels, aiming to promote high-quality development for both parties.
